Answer:
z^2 = -12y
Step-by-step explanation:
Given the vertex at origin;
This is same as (0,0)
The focus (0,-3)
The general form is;
(z-h)^2 = 4p(y-k)
(h,k) is the vertex (0,0); so h = 0 and k = 0
The focus is given as;
(h,k + p)
so ;
k + p = -3
but k =0
so p = -3
Thus, the equation of the parabola is;
(z-0)^2 = 4(-3)(y-0)
z^2 = -12y
